Output aaace8e301c3273a405209ea54efc062a2828bca624c72bf2affb7b758b48040:15

value
4141256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c929213038e50d9b3bf4a3ad1ffb16c6cbc15050 OP_EQUAL
address
3L2f1qdeory7YYg7ZXFjNTK4XNTtF8ujUA
transaction
aaace8e301c3273a405209ea54efc062a2828bca624c72bf2affb7b758b48040
confirmations
429936
spent
true